Khanduri condemns Mumbai attacks
Dehra Dun, Nov 27 (UNI) Uttarakhand Chief Minister Maj Gen (retd) B C Khanduri has stongly condemned the Mumbai terror attacks and said there was a need for a strong anti-terror law to effectively deal with terrorism.
In a statement, Gen Khanduri condoled the demise of police officers who lost their lives in the line of duty along with innocents and prayed for the recovery of the injured.
Stating that terrorism had no religion, He appealed to the people of the country to stand united and fight the menace of terrorism.
He also called for enhanced coordination between the Centre and the state security agencies in the interest of national security.
